Gordon Ramsay Marks 29 Years of Marriage With Heartfelt Tribute to His Wife

Gordon and Tana Ramsay have celebrated another milestone in their long-lasting partnership, marking an impressive 29 years of marriage.

The couple, both widely respected for their accomplishments and for their dedication to family life, honored the occasion on Sunday, December 21, 2025. Gordon, now 59, shared a warm and emotional tribute on Instagram, reflecting on the years they have spent growing together through life’s challenges and triumphs. “29yrs ago I got to marry my best friend,” he wrote, posting a collection of throwback wedding photos alongside recent snapshots of the two enjoying everyday moments. “What a journey and thank you ❤️ Love you so much ❤️.”

How Their Story Began

Tana Ramsay first crossed paths with Gordon at a New Year’s Eve party in her twenties. In a 2008 interview with The Guardian, she openly recalled her first impression of the young chef, describing him as “a complete arrogant arse.” Their story did not end there, though. They met again at a flat Tana shared with a friend, and that second encounter sparked a connection that would lead to a committed relationship.

The couple began dating soon after, and their relationship deepened quickly. In December 1996, they were married in a ceremony surrounded by family and friends, laying the foundation for the life, love, and shared experiences that would follow over nearly three decades.

The Secret Behind Their Strong Marriage

Over the years, Gordon has often emphasized the importance of prioritizing quality time. In a 2024 interview with PEOPLE, he said, “Date nights are crucial, whether it’s the cinema, whether it’s going out for a drive. We have a little time, but it’s quality, and so that is really important.” This belief in nurturing their connection has played a major role in the strength of their marriage.

Despite both having demanding schedules—Gordon as an award-winning chef and television personality, and Tana as a cookbook author, culinary figure, and former teacher—they continue to support one another’s ambitions while keeping family at the heart of everything they do.

Growing Their Family: Six Children Across Two Decades

Gordon and Tana Ramsay built a large, loving family over the years, welcoming six children who have each brought their own joy and meaning to their lives.

Their first daughter, Megan, was born in 1998. A year later, in 1999, they welcomed twins Holly and Jack. Their fourth child, Matilda—known affectionately as Tilly—arrived in 2001 and has since grown into a vibrant media personality.

In 2016, the family experienced a heartbreaking miscarriage, a loss Gordon and Tana later shared publicly in hopes of offering comfort to others who had faced similar pain. Their family grew again in 2019 with the arrival of their son Oscar, and in 2023, their youngest child, Jesse, completed the Ramsay household.

The Ramsays frequently express that parenthood has brought them perspective and gratitude, reshaping their understanding of family and strengthening their bond.
